The First Cry of the Revolution


          The primary sources are accounts pertaining to the first cry for
freedom that has either took place in Bahay Toro, Pugad Lawin or Biyak na
Bato. The sources present different versions that would give light to, not
only where such first cry took place, but equally important is to the
realization of the struggle of the men and women of the Katipunan and their
resolve to put an end to oppression and injustice. The sources also
highlight the primary contribution of the hero and revolutionary leader
Supremo Andres Bonifacio of starting the fight against the Spanish colonial
masters.
